Featured Retouching Sample 04:
We wanted to create a symetrical and polished graphic image featuring the various products available in this cosmetics range and decided, in this case, that the original photography was not really good enough for what we wanted to produce. Also, part of the project was to retouch all the individual items rather than in part of a group.
My solution was to create a path of the shape of the bottle, take the best bottle top - and use this for every item. I took the original artwork (from Illustrator) for the labels to accurately position a new label and painted in an appropriate colour for each bottles contents. For the 'polished look', I think it is important that the images match up. Finally, I created some highlights along the contours to accentuate the 3D shape.
Finally, I placed all the items together and added a reflection, which was incorporated into the design of the final poster.
